腾讯云访问Linux图形界面的主要方式是通过远程桌面协议(RDP)或VNC(Virtual Network Computing)实现。具体步骤包括安装图形界面、配置远程访问工具,然后通过本地电脑的远程桌面客户端连接。以下是详细的分析和操作步骤。
1. 安装图形界面
腾讯云的Linux服务器默认通常只安装命令行界面(CLI),因此首先需要安装图形界面。以Ubuntu系统为例,可以通过以下命令安装GNOME桌面环境:
sudo apt update
sudo apt install ubuntu-desktop
对于CentOS系统,可以安装GNOME或KDE桌面环境:
sudo yum groupinstall "GNOME Desktop" "Graphical Administration Tools"
安装完成后,需要设置系统默认启动图形界面:
sudo systemctl set-default graphical.target
2. 配置远程访问工具
使用VNC
VNC是一种常用的远程图形界面访问工具。首先安装VNC服务器:
sudo apt install tightvncserver # Ubuntu
sudo yum install tigervnc-server # CentOS
启动VNC服务器并设置密码:
vncserver
配置VNC服务器以使用GNOME桌面环境。编辑~/.vnc/xstartup文件,添加以下内容:
#!/bin/sh
unset SESSION_MANAGER
unset DBUS_SESSION_BUS_ADDRESS
exec /etc/X11/xinit/xinitrc
保存后赋予执行权限:
chmod +x ~/.vnc/xstartup
重启VNC服务器:
vncserver -kill :1
vncserver
使用RDP
RDP是Windows远程桌面的协议,但也可以通过xrdp在Linux上实现。安装xrdp:
sudo apt install xrdp # Ubuntu
sudo yum install xrdp # CentOS
启动xrdp服务并设置开机自启:
sudo systemctl start xrdp
sudo systemctl enable xrdp
3. 本地连接
使用VNC客户端
在本地电脑安装VNC客户端(如RealVNC、TightVNC),输入服务器的IP地址和端口号(默认为5901),然后输入VNC密码即可连接。
使用RDP客户端
在Windows上使用自带的“远程桌面连接”工具,输入服务器的IP地址,使用Linux系统的用户名和密码登录。
4. 安全配置
为了确保远程访问的安全性,建议采取以下措施:
- 使用强密码并定期更换。
- 配置防火墙,仅允许特定IP访问VNC或RDP端口。
- 使用SSH隧道加密VNC或RDP连接。
通过以上步骤,您可以成功在腾讯云上访问Linux图形界面,方便进行图形化操作和管理。
CLOUD知识